If you renew your passport between late 2019 and early 2020, you'll be issued with either a blue or a burgundy British passport. You will not be able to choose whether you get a burgundy or a blue passport during this time. All British passports issued from early 2020 will be blue.29 Mar 2019

Blue passports will begin to be issued from October 2019, but there will be a period when blue & burgundy are being issued at the same time, while stocks are used up.
